Statute of limitations

Mesothelioma victims and their families need to work quickly to meet legal filing deadlines known as the statute of limitations. The timelines vary depending on the state of the victim and the type of claim and whether it is personal injury or wrongful death case. Furthermore, some victims might qualify for an extension of the statute of limitations or other exceptions in certain circumstances. An attorney for mesothelioma can assist asbestos victims and their loved ones understand their deadlines and how they can best approach their claims.

The statute of limitations starts to expire when a victim is diagnosed with mesothelioma. The statute of limitations for filing a mesothelioma lawsuit begins to run when the person should have reasonably discovered that their condition resulted by exposure to asbestos. Therefore, it is important for patients to speak with a mesothelioma law firm as soon as possible.

Mesothelioma lawyers have years of knowledge of the various statutes of limitations for asbestos lawsuits. They will review all the state laws that apply to your specific situation and determine when deadlines apply. They will also discuss other factors that could affect the statute of limitations such as your present and past location of residence, the state in which you were exposed to asbestos and which companies you worked for.

Once the mesothelioma statute of limitations is determined the lawyer will then begin the process of litigation. This includes gathering the necessary information, preparing and the lawsuit, submitting it, responding to the defendants' requests for discovery, and proceeding through trial if needed.

Damages

Mesothelioma victims can claim compensation for the many expenses resulting from asbestos exposure. This includes lost wages, medical bills and other financial losses. Victims can also receive compensation for their suffering and pain. Compensation can also help families pay funeral costs and caregiving expenses, as well as other costs.

A top mesothelioma lawyer can help determine the value of your case and determine how much compensation you might be able to claim. They will take into account various factors, including the number and type of companies involved, defendants' past asbestos lawsuits, as well as your own exposure history. They will make use of these factors to build a strong argument on your behalf.

Once your lawyer has gathered all the information needed, they will file a mesothelioma lawsuit. The defendants are provided with an electronic copy of the lawsuit and have 30 calendar days to respond. During this period, attorneys on both sides will exchange discovery documents and conduct depositions of witnesses.

Certain mesothelioma cases can reach an agreement to settle the case prior to the trial date. This is advantageous for the patient, since they will get a fixed amount of money straight away and avoid the uncertainty of a verdict at trial. A trial may be necessary when defendants refuse to settle for an acceptable amount.

Most mesothelioma lawsuits are settled instead of going to trial. Asbestos companies don't want larger amount of money in a verdict or risk losing the case, which is why mesothelioma lawyers will do everything they can to negotiate an agreement. Additionally, a mesothelioma settlement will give faster payout instead of waiting for a trial verdict.

Your lawyer will draft and submit documents for your lawsuit to your local court during the process of litigation. This could take up to 18 months. After the defendant responds to your lawsuit, the information-gathering phase of discovery will begin. This can involve written or in-person depositions. Your lawyer will collect and compile the necessary information to construct a convincing case for you, and determine how much compensation is appropriate.

While it's not common for mesothelioma lawsuits to go to trial however, your lawyer will be prepared to go to trial should it be necessary. A trial in a courtroom is conducted by a jury or judge who will examine the evidence and decide whether you should be awarded compensation and how much you deserve.

Mesothelioma suits are typically filed as personal injury lawsuits, but wrongful-death suits can be brought on behalf of the family member of the victim. In wrongful death cases, you claim that exposure of your loved one to asbestos led to their death. In most cases, mesothelioma wrongful deaths are settled through private discussions with the defendants' attorneys before reaching a trial verdict. In the past, a few of these claims were handled as class actions, however these days, most cases are handled as individual. If your mesothelioma case is part of an MDL your lawsuit may be consolidated with others.
